The primary objective of CPR is to keep blood flow to vital organs up until professional clinical assistance gets here or regular heart function is restored.
The Value of CPR in Emergencies
CPR is vital in numerous situations, consisting of heart attack, drowning, choking cases, and various other circumstances causing unconsciousness or unresponsiveness. According to research studies from organizations like the American Heart Association, effective CPR can increase and even triple a victim's chance of survival.

History of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ation
Early Methods for Restoring Individuals
The origins of CPR go back centuries earlier. Historical records show that approaches similar to contemporary resuscitation were exercised as early as 3000 B.C., primarily concentrating on mouth-to-mouth techniques for restoring drowning victims.
Modern Growths in CPR Techniques
In the 20th century, considerable advancements were made in understanding heart attack and its treatment. In 1960, Dr. Peter Safar introduced mouth-to-mouth resuscitation integrated with upper body compressions-- laying the groundwork wherefore would certainly become referred to as modern-day CPR.
CPR Methods: Fundamentals You Need to Know
A Step-by-Step Guide: Exactly How to Execute CPR
To successfully carry out CPR, it's essential to adhere to a methodical technique:
Check Responsiveness: Delicately tremble the person and ask if they're okay. Call for Help: If there's no feedback, telephone call emergency situation services immediately. Determine Breathing: Seek regular breathing; otherwise present or irregular (wheezing), begin compressions. Chest Compressions:
- Place your hands on the center of the individual's chest. Keep your arm joints straight. Compress set at a rate of 100-120 compressions per minute.
- After 30 compressions, offer 2 rescue breaths. Ensure proper head tilt-chin lift placement before providing breaths.
Hands-Only vs Conventional CPR
Many people question whether hands-only or traditional CPR is extra effective. For adults that collapse because of heart attack outside a health center setup, hands-only CPR has shown similarly effective-- making it less complicated for inexperienced spectators to intervene without concern of improper technique.
